Edward A. Eichelberger

YORK HAVEN- Edward A. Eichelberger, 64, died on Saturday, January 19, 2013 at his residence. Services for Mr. Eichelberger are private at the convenience of the family. Life Tributes by Olewiler & Heffner Funeral Chapel & Crematory, Inc., 35 Gotham Pl., Red Lion is in charge of arrangements. Born on September 24, 1948, he was a son of Gladys I. (Anderson) Eichelberger and the late Wilbur W. Eichelberger, Sr. Edward worked as a Fork Lift Operator for Army Depot. Mr. Eichelberger was a member of the Red Lion-Felton Band. He had a passion for old cars and enjoyed spending time with his dog, Liberty. Mr. Eichelberger served our country for three years in the U.S. Army during the Vietnam War. Ed is survived by a brother, Terry Eichelberger of Wrightsville; a sister, Sandy Eichelberger of Airville; three nephews, Kenneth and Kevin Eichelberger and Russell Mellinger; a niece, Nichole McCauley; and a great niece, Karrissa McCauley. He was preceded in death by a brother, Wilbur W. Eichelberger, Jr.
